Yaakov Klapholtz was born in Slovakia, Czechoslovakia. He was a disabled and married to Berta nee Huber. Prior to WWII he lived in Bratislava, Czechoslovakia. During the war he was in Slovakia, Czechoslovakia.
Yaakov was murdered in the Shoah. Place of death: unknown, 1942.
